The Lava Beds
South of Ketchum, Idaho
Trip Day Twenty-four: July 5, 2000
Much of Idaho and Eastern Washington is covered with lava beds hundreds of feet thick.
We didn't take time to drive the 45 miles to Craters of the Moon National Monument,
but these lava flows were right next to Idaho State Highway 75 near US-20.
